P2P(Peer-to-Peer)網(wǎng)絡(luò)技術(shù)服務(wù)是一種去中心化的通信模式,它允許網(wǎng)絡(luò)中的每個(gè)節(jié)點(diǎn)(即參與者)直接共享資源,而不需要依賴(lài)中央服務(wù)器。這種技術(shù)自誕生以來(lái),深刻改變了文件共享、通信和分布式計(jì)算等領(lǐng)域。
1. P2P網(wǎng)絡(luò)的基本原理
P2P網(wǎng)絡(luò)的核心思想是去中心化。與傳統(tǒng)的客戶(hù)端-服務(wù)器模式不同,P2P網(wǎng)絡(luò)中的每個(gè)節(jié)點(diǎn)既是客戶(hù)端也是服務(wù)器,能夠直接與其他節(jié)點(diǎn)交換數(shù)據(jù)、存儲(chǔ)信息或提供計(jì)算能力。這大大提高了網(wǎng)絡(luò)的擴(kuò)展性和魯棒性,因?yàn)椴淮嬖趩吸c(diǎn)故障。
2. P2P網(wǎng)絡(luò)的主要類(lèi)型
P2P網(wǎng)絡(luò)可以分為兩大類(lèi):
- 純P2P網(wǎng)絡(luò):完全沒(méi)有中央服務(wù)器,節(jié)點(diǎn)通過(guò)自組織方式連接和通信,如早期的Gnutella協(xié)議。
- 混合P2P網(wǎng)絡(luò):在去中心化的基礎(chǔ)上,引入少量中央服務(wù)器用于協(xié)調(diào)節(jié)點(diǎn)發(fā)現(xiàn)或資源索引,例如BitTorrent協(xié)議中的Tracker服務(wù)器。
3. P2P技術(shù)的應(yīng)用領(lǐng)域
P2P技術(shù)廣泛應(yīng)用于多個(gè)領(lǐng)域:
- 文件共享:如BitTorrent、eMule等平臺(tái),用戶(hù)可以直接下載和上傳文件,提高了傳輸效率。
- 通信與協(xié)作:Skype(早期版本)和區(qū)塊鏈技術(shù)(如比特幣網(wǎng)絡(luò))利用P2P架構(gòu)實(shí)現(xiàn)去中心化的語(yǔ)音通話和交易驗(yàn)證。
- 分布式計(jì)算:項(xiàng)目如SETI@home利用全球志愿者的計(jì)算資源處理復(fù)雜數(shù)據(jù)。
- 內(nèi)容分發(fā):P2P CDN(內(nèi)容分發(fā)網(wǎng)絡(luò))通過(guò)節(jié)點(diǎn)緩存內(nèi)容,減輕服務(wù)器負(fù)載。
4. P2P技術(shù)的優(yōu)勢(shì)與挑戰(zhàn)
P2P網(wǎng)絡(luò)具有顯著優(yōu)勢(shì):
- 可擴(kuò)展性:隨著節(jié)點(diǎn)增加,網(wǎng)絡(luò)資源和服務(wù)能力自然提升。
- 成本效益:減少對(duì)昂貴服務(wù)器的依賴(lài),降低運(yùn)營(yíng)成本。
- 容錯(cuò)性:節(jié)點(diǎn)故障不影響整體網(wǎng)絡(luò)運(yùn)行。
P2P技術(shù)也面臨挑戰(zhàn):
- 安全與隱私風(fēng)險(xiǎn):惡意節(jié)點(diǎn)可能傳播病毒或侵犯用戶(hù)隱私。
- 法律與監(jiān)管問(wèn)題:文件共享應(yīng)用常涉及版權(quán)爭(zhēng)議。
- 性能波動(dòng):節(jié)點(diǎn)加入和退出可能導(dǎo)致網(wǎng)絡(luò)不穩(wěn)定。
5. 未來(lái)發(fā)展與趨勢(shì)
隨著區(qū)塊鏈、物聯(lián)網(wǎng)和5G技術(shù)的興起,P2P網(wǎng)絡(luò)正迎來(lái)新的機(jī)遇。例如,去中心化金融(DeFi)和分布式存儲(chǔ)系統(tǒng)(如IPFS)都基于P2P原理構(gòu)建。未來(lái),P2P技術(shù)有望在數(shù)據(jù)主權(quán)、邊緣計(jì)算和抗審查通信中發(fā)揮更大作用,但也需解決安全與效率的平衡問(wèn)題。
P2P網(wǎng)絡(luò)技術(shù)服務(wù)是一種強(qiáng)大的去中心化工具,它重塑了數(shù)字世界的交互方式。理解其原理和應(yīng)用,有助于我們更好地把握技術(shù)發(fā)展趨勢(shì),并在實(shí)踐中規(guī)避風(fēng)險(xiǎn)、發(fā)揮優(yōu)勢(shì)。